Ammunition Handling Systems Market Overview

The global ammunition handling systems market size was valued at USD 4.64 billion in 2025. The market is projected to grow from USD 5.10 billion in 2026 to USD 10.81 billion by 2034, exhibiting a CAGR of 9.85% during the forecast period.

The Ammunition Handling Systems Market is a critical segment within the defense and military equipment industry, focusing on automated and semi-automated systems used for storage, transportation, and loading of ammunition. Hoist System: Hoist systems account for approximately 18% of the Ammunition Handling Systems Market Share, primarily used in naval platforms for vertical ammunition transport between storage and firing systems. The Ammunition Handling Systems Market Analysis indicates that hoist systems improve operational efficiency by nearly 28%, enabling rapid ammunition transfer in multi-level structures. These systems are used in approximately 50% of naval vessels equipped with advanced weapon systems. The Ammunition Handling Systems Market Report highlights that hoist systems reduce manual handling requirements by approximately 30%, improving safety.
